Fear not! We checked with Paris and Napoleon's still hosts dueling pianos nightly, it's just that the show has moved to a later spot, now that the new Empire Comedy club has opened. Sunday through Wednesday, the pianos still start at 9 p.m.; on Thursday they now begin at 9:45 p.m., and at 11:30 p.m. Friday and Saturdy.
We have lost several other options, however, since we last answered a QoD on this subject, back in June, 2008. McFadden's at the Rio closed recently, although a new Irish pub is apparently due to open. The Delmar Lounge at South Point no longer hosts dueling pianos, and neither do Rock and Rita's at Circus Circus, nor Kahunaville at TI. We have just gained two new options, though, with the opening of Lynrd Skynrd BBQ & Beer at Excalibur, which has dueling pianos at 9 p.m. on Tuesdays and Wednesdays, and Swingers Club at the Plaza, which has a dueling piano show Fridays, Saturdays, and Sundays from 8 p.m.
The other options we're aware of are The Piano Bar at Harrah's, which has dueling twin sister pianists at 9 p.m. nightly, The Bar at Times Square in New York-New York, which has its famed show at 8 p.m. nightly, The Pub at the Monte Carlo, which features dueling pianos at 9 p.m. Thursday through Saturday, Encore's Eastside Lounge, which has a show at 9 p.m. nightly, Salute Lounge at Palazzo, from 7:30 p.m. nightly, and Pete's Dueling Piano Bar at Town Square, where the show goes off at 8 p.m., Wednesday through Saturday.
